Gates Antiques Ltd. is a premier antique store located in Midlothian, Virginia, just 15 miles southwest of Richmond. Spread across multiple buildings, this well-curated establishment offers an extensive collection of high-quality furniture, home decor, and unique collectibles from the 19th and early 20th centuries.
The store's four showrooms are meticulously organized, with themed rooms and settings that allow customers to envision how the antique pieces would look in their own homes. The multi-level layout features both upstairs and downstairs areas, providing ample space to browse the store's impressive inventory of American and European antique furniture. Visitors can discover a wide range of items, including ornate armoires, elegant sideboards, and intricately carved chairs. Beyond furniture, Gates Antiques also specializes in a diverse array of antique collectibles, from vintage glassware and porcelain to rare books and artwork.
The knowledgeable staff at Gates Antiques are passionate about antiques and are always eager to share their expertise with customers. They are committed to providing exceptional customer service and can assist with a range of services, including furniture repair and restoration, antique appraisals, and educational classes on antique furniture and collecting. I was recently gifted a three+ century old blanket chest. The chest is amazing but as with anything of that age it needed a little work. There were two concerns I noted that I wanted addressed so I reached out to Gates Antiques since they were just down the road from me and were so highly rated. A decorative piece was missing on one side that I wanted replicated and there were a couple of loose structural joints. Jay looked the pieced over noted one other issue with original wrought iron hinges. What I really like about Jay (and later his mother who I got to talk with when I picked up the chest) is they have a passion for antique furniture. Jay was great because he respected the history of the piece and didn't try to upsell me in anyway. He did exactly what was needed no more and no less. The reproduction decorative piece they made is perfect. It is almost a clone of the original and only upon close inspection would reveal itself to not be original. Structurally the chest is now solid. Jay's team did a great job, delivered on time and were very reasonably priced for their skillset. My blanket chest is now ready for another 100 years. The other thing I like about Jay and his mother was they willingly shared their knowledge. Both of them gave me information that I was unaware of despite researching what I had prior to taking it to them.
